#243608 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#243608 is composed of 14.1% red, 21.2%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 33.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 85.2% yellow and 78.8% black. It has a hue angle of 83.5 degrees, a saturation of 74.2% and a lightness of 12.2%. #243608 color hex could be obtained by blending #486c10 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#243608 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#243608 has RGB values of R:36, G:54,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0.33, M:0, Y:0.85, K:0.79. Its decimal value is 2373128.
